    Here is a little info on the shop. They have an online store but do not sell the fabric online. The shops name is Shane Lee and they are a clothing manufacturer that decided to sell the fabric's in the store front. They open a shop in Paducah during the AQS. She said that in April they will be getting new prints and have good sales then too. I bought some that were priced $4.99/yd and she only charged me $2.99/yd. today. In think this is gonna be my new place to shop from now on. That is until I have every print in the store. LOL!!!!
